It was Jimi Hendrix who strangely intoned more than
35 years ago that"you will never hear surf music again," He
was half-right. The Lost Patrol as least proves that you'll never hear
surf music in the same way again. Where do three New Jerseyites and a
single New Yorker get the right to play surf music? Hard to say, but one
earful of the atmospheric twang blasted out by The Lost Patrol and odds
are you probably won't care. The group's sound combines not only the twisted,
reverb drenched lines favored by The Ventures but also healthy doses of
spaghetti-Western intimidation, goth-laden pop and ridiculously catchy
lounge leanings." - Ryan Muldoon
